Dual 12-core Xeon server

The HP ProLiant DL380 Gen9 is a 2U rack server fitted with two Xeon E5-2670 v3 processors, each running at 2.3 GHz with 12 cores. Sixteen gigabytes of DDR4 ECC registered memory are installed across 24 DIMM slots. Two 146 GB 15K SAS drives connect through a Smart HBA H240ar controller supporting RAID 0, 1, 5, 6, 10, 50 and 60. Dual 500 W hot-swap power supplies provide redundancy.

Upgrade from single-socket or lower-core systems

The jump is worthwhile when workloads need more parallel threads than a single processor can deliver. Forty-eight logical cores with hyper-threading suit virtualisation hosts, database nodes and compute clusters that saturate fewer cores. The 24 DIMM slots allow memory to scale far beyond the factory 16 GB limit when applications demand it. Additional drive bays and NVMe options let storage grow without replacing the chassis.

Suits density-focused deployments

This server fits buyers who need high core counts in a 2U footprint with redundant power and hardware RAID. Organisations requiring GPU acceleration, larger single-thread performance or newer instruction sets should evaluate other platforms. Buyers who want more storage bays than the eight SFF slots provide, or who need integrated graphics beyond the Matrox G200eH2, should look at alternative configurations.

Questions about this item

What rack height does this 2U server require?

This unit occupies 2U of rack height and fits standard racks; sliding rails are required but are not included.

How are the 146 GB SAS drives installed in the 8 SFF bays?

Insert each 2.5-inch drive into its supplied tray and slide it into one of the 8 front SFF bays; the H240ar controller auto-detects them.

When should the 500 W redundant power supplies be replaced?

Replace a supply when its amber fault LED lights or iLO reports a power-supply failure; the redundant design lets you swap one unit while the server stays on.
